Anglia Ruskin Research Online (ARRO)
Browse

Federated learning-based intrusion detection system for the internet of things using unsupervised and supervised deep learning models

Download (1.73 MB)
journal contribution
posted on 2024-10-17, 11:02 authored by Babatunde Olanrewaju-George, Bernardi Pranggono
The adoption of the Internet of Things (IoT) in our technology-driven society is hindered by security and data privacy challenges. To address these issues, Artificial Intelligence (AI) techniques such as Machine Learning (ML) and Deep Learning (DL) can be applied to build Intrusion Detection Systems (IDS) that help securing IoT networks. Federated Learning (FL) is a decentralized approach that can enhance performance and privacy of the data by training IDS on individual connected devices. This study proposes the use of unsupervised and supervised DL models trained via FL to develop IDS for IoT devices. The performance of FL-trained models is compared to models trained via non-FL using the N-BaIoT dataset of nine IoT devices. To improve the accuracy of DL models, a randomized search hyperparameter optimization is performed. Various performance metrics are used to evaluate the prediction results. The results indicate that the unsupervised AutoEncoder (AE) model trained via FL is the best overall in terms of all metrics, based on testing both FL and non-FL trained models on all nine IoT devices.

History

Refereed

  • Yes

Volume

3

Page range

100068-100068

Publication title

Cyber Security and Applications

ISSN

2772-9184

Publisher

Elsevier BV

File version

  • Published version

Language

  • eng

Item sub-type

Journal Article

Affiliated with

  • School of Computing and Information Science Outputs

Usage metrics

    ARU Outputs

    Exports

    RefWorks
    BibTeX
    Ref. manager
    Endnote
    DataCite
    NLM
    DC